🌱Day 7: Hey Mama, It’s Time to Sow

Scripture:
“Sow your seed in the morning, and at evening let your hands not be idle, for you do not know which will succeed, whether this or that, or whether both will do equally well.”

‭‭Ecclesiastes‬ ‭11‬:‭6‬ ‭NIV‬‬

Devotional:
You’ve prayed. You’ve dreamed. You’ve felt the tug to write. But at some point, the seed has to leave your hand and touch the soil.

This is your time.

We often wait for perfect clarity, the right conditions, or a sign from heaven. But sometimes, the confirmation comes after the obedience. The fruit doesn’t come before the sowing — it comes because of it.

God is inviting you to release what He’s placed inside you. Your book doesn’t have to be perfect — just planted.

Even if you’ve never written before… even if you feel unsure… even if you’ve started and stopped a hundred times —start again.

Your story is sacred. Your words will take root. It’s time to sow.

Reflection Question:
What is one action you can take this week to move forward with the book God placed in your heart?

Prayer:
Lord, I don’t want to bury what You’ve given me. I want to sow it in faith. Help me take the next step, even if it’s small. Let my obedience bear fruit for Your glory and the good of others. Amen.

You are Commissioned to Write

Scripture:
“You did not choose me, but I chose you and appointed you so that you might go and bear fruit — fruit that will last.” — John 15:16 (NIV)


You were chosen — not just for salvation, but for fruitfulness. God has appointed you to bear lasting fruit. And writing is one of the ways you do that.

This isn’t about writing to be noticed. It’s about writing to be obedient.

The words you write today can become the fruit someone else eats tomorrow. A book can disciple someone long after you’ve left the room. That’s legacy.

You are not just “a mom who writes.” You are a woman appointed to bear fruit — through words, wisdom, and witness.

Now, go and write.

Reflection Question:
What lasting fruit do you hope your writing will produce?

Jesus, thank You for choosing me and appointing me to bear fruit. I offer You my voice, my story, and my obedience. Let everything I write bring glory to You and transformation to others. Amen.
